import java.util.ArrayList;
import java.util.Collections;
import java.util.List;

public class Test {
    public static void main(String[] args) {
        List list=new ArrayList();
        for (int i = 1; i <=100; i++) {
            list.add(i);
        }
        System.out.println("翻转前:");
        System.out.println(list);
        Collections.reverse(list.subList(39, 60));
        System.out.println("翻转后:");
        System.out.println(list);
    }
}
